A Great Deal of Explanation
The 7 Days Of Holidays Event left many players confused. After the Family Property, most of us are used to it. My less than stellar explanation must have been noticed because the instructions were updated. This event does require that player who participate spend Reward Point so Zynga was on top of the situation.
The old explanation stated  "you can purchase a deal as many times as you want as long as you have more numbers of the previous deal". It took this to mean that I would need 2 Day 1 Deal items to purchase 1 Day 2 Deal item. Last time I checked, 2 was "more numbers" than 1.
My interpretation was off. The "How the Deals work" instructions have changed and now it says "you can purchase a particular deal as long as you have purchased at least one more previous deal". An example was given this time and they say on "On Day 3 if you have 5 Day-2 Deals then you can purchase up to 5 Day-3 Deals. The example helps because it looks like you can buy 1 Day-2 Deal if you have 1 Day-1 Deal. The instructions are still bad (save the example) because it says "at least one more". If taken literally (one more than one is two), this would mean I need 2 Day-1 items to buy 1 Day-2 item. The example doesn't fit the description. We will know for sure in about 4 hours from now when Deal 2 unlocks. No matter how you look at it, using Reward Points to buy loot items is never a deal.
